As per the Annamali University Cutoff 2024, the Round 3 closing rank for MBBS admission was 17596, for the General All India category.  Among the OBC AI category candidates, the cutoff was closed at 17844. For the SC AI category candidates, the cutoff rank was closed at 136699. For the ST AI category, the cutoff rank for MBBS was 159902. Candidates can find the Annamali University Cutoff details here

Sengunthar Engineering College, established in 2001 is a private college and is located in Namakkal, Tamil Nadu. The college was established by the Sengunthar Charitable Trust and started its journey from 2007-2008 to uplift the women students. From 2010 to 2011, the college was converted into a co-educational college with a total campus area of 12.83 acres.

SRM IST in Chennai has a good track record in terms of placement for the College of Pharmacy. About 85% of the students get placed, and companies such as Abbott and Nestle recruit on campus besides TCS. The highest salary is about INR 9 Lakhs per annum and the average varies between INR 3.4 to 5 Lakhs per year. The placement cell of the college has efficiently managed to arrange internships and job opportunities. The students will be well prepared for entering the job market. For the TNEA 2025 admissions to B.E./B.Tech programs at R.M.K. Engineering College and other participating institutions in Tamil Nadu, the application process is expected to start in May 2025, with online registration and document upload concluding in the first week of June 2025. Following this, random numbers will be assigned, and certificate verification will take place in June 2025. The TNEA rank list will likely be published in the fourth week of June 2025, and the counseling process is expected to occur from June to September 2025.

Normally, to get into the B.E./B.Tech course at PERI Institute of Technology, you'd need to go through TNEA (Tamil Nadu Engineering Admissions) for counseling. It's the main process for getting admitted to most engineering colleges in Tamil Nadu, including PERIIT. However, in some cases, if you're from outside Tamil Nadu or if there are leftover seats, you might be able to apply through the management quota or direct admission. This could bypass TNEA, but you'll need to check with the college directly for those specific options.

The fees for courses at PERI Institute of Technology (PERIT) are relatively affordable, especially for an engineering college in Chennai. For B.E./B.Tech, the tuition fees are usually around 55,000 to 65,000 per year, depending on the course and specialization. The hostel fees range between 40,000 to 60,000 annually, with the exact cost depending on the type of accommodation and facilities. There might be additional costs for activities, exams, or other services too.It's not too expensive compared to some private colleges, but it's still something to consider based on your budget
